I got just a few things I've been thinking about,

1: How much damage would a human bite do? d4? d2?
No more than a d3. Maybe d2.

2: Some creatures have a slam attack. What does a slam attack look like? Is it like a punch?
It can. I've always thought of it as looking more like a double-fisted punch. If you watch wrestling, think "double axe handle."

3: When any ability score hits 0 due to poison/ability drain/whatever the creature dies right, or is only when CON hits 0?
Just Con. Everything else makes you unconscious/paralyzed.
